The Nigeria Police Force in Sokoto State has announced that the physical and credential screening exercise for applicants seeking recruitment as police constables will begin on March 9, 2026.
The Sokoto State Police Command said the screening exercise will run from March 9 to April 18, 2026, and will take place at the Command Headquarters located on Gwandu Road. The exercise is scheduled to start at 7:00 a.m. daily throughout the period.
The announcement was contained in a statement issued on Thursday by the Police Public Relations Officer of the command, Ahmad Rufa’i.
Rufa’i explained that the screening exercise forms part of the recruitment process for new police constables and urged all applicants who successfully completed the online registration to verify their status ahead of the physical screening.
He advised candidates to log in to the official recruitment portal to confirm whether they have been shortlisted and to print out the necessary documents required for participation in the exercise.
According to the statement, only applicants whose names appear on the portal and who possess the required documentation will be allowed to take part in the screening process.
“Candidates are required to report strictly on the date indicated on their invitation slip and must come with all required documents neatly arranged in two white flat files,” the statement read.
The command further emphasised the importance of punctuality and compliance with all instructions provided on the invitation slip, noting that failure to appear on the scheduled date may lead to disqualification from the recruitment process.
Applicants were also advised to ensure that the documents they present during the screening are genuine and complete, as the exercise will involve thorough verification of credentials and personal details.
The police authorities reiterated that the recruitment process is free and transparent, warning applicants against paying money to individuals or groups claiming to offer assistance or influence in the selection process.
The command encouraged candidates to remain vigilant and report any suspicious activities related to the recruitment exercise to the appropriate authorities.
